Terra Firma, the private equity firm led by Guy Hands, has gone head-to-head with investment group 3i in the £112 million takeover battle for Novera Energy, one of the UK's biggest renewable energy groups.
Novera, which has a mix of landfill gas, hydro-electric and wind farm energy developments, confirmed yesterday that Infinis, the landfill gas outfit backed by Terra Firma, had approached the group. Last month, 3i Infrastructure confirmed it was behind a takeover approach for Novera, the latest move in a spate of consolidation activity within the sector. 3i has built up a 10 per cent stake in Novera.
Mr Hands is one of the UK's most successful private equity magnates, and is best known for his takeover of EMI last year.
Novera, which reports annual results today, said in a statement that it was “continuing negotiations with 3i Infrastructure concerning a possible cash offer for ... Novera at a price of 90p per share”, valuing the company at £112 million.
“The Board of Novera also announces that on February 18 2008 it received an approach from Infinis Acquisitions,” the company said.
A takeover of Novera would be a major filip for Infinis, also one of Britain's biggest renewable energy players, which has ambitious expansion plans. It was speculated yesterday that Infinis had also made an approach for Novera at 90p after 9.4 million Novera shares were bought at that price. However, Andrew Shepherd-Barron, an analyst in KBC Peel Hunt, said at 90p, any bid was “opportunistic” and that an offer of 149p was more realistic. “Alternative energy is valuable, particularly at times of high fossil fuel prices,” Mr Shepherd-Barron said. The shares closed yesterday at 88p, a rise of 5.4 per cent.
Neither 3i nor Infinis can make a formal offer for Novera until the alternative energy group settles a disagreement with Waste Recycling Group, on whose landfill sites it operates. A court hearing on the dispute is due to be heard next month. Novera can generate about 122MW of power and plans to increase capacity to 250MW by 2011.
